From: Construction and evaluation of a prognostic model based on the expression of the metabolism-related signatures in patients with osteosarcoma

Fig. 3

Screening of independent prognostic clinical factors. A. The KM curves of age. Left: age in the TCGA prognostic KM curve. Green and red represent the KM curves of the sample group below or above 65 years of age, respectively. Middle and right: KM curves related to prognosis based on the prognosis score prediction model for the sample groups aged under and over 65 years old. Green and red curves represent low- and high-risk samples, respectively. B. The KM curves of metastasis. Left: tumor metastatic factors in TCGA sample prognostic KM curves. Green and red represent the KM curves of the sample group below or above 65 years of age, respectively. Middle and right: KM curves related to prognosis based on the prognosis score prediction model for the sample groups with and without tumor metastasis. Green and red curves represent low- and high-risk samples, respectively
